Understanding the EPC Business Environment

Winning EPC projects is rarely determined by technical capability alone. The most successful organizations combine engineering expertise with:

  • Strategic market positioning
  • Long-term client engagement
  • Early project visibility
  • Trusted technology partners
  • Reliable vendor ecosystems
  • Commercial intelligence
  • Risk-aware bid strategies
  • Strong industrial relationships

Projects are won long before contracts are signed.

Bid Strategy & Opportunity Qualification

Not every tender should be pursued. We support EPC companies in evaluating opportunities before committing valuable engineering and commercial resources. Typical areas include:

  • Bid / No-Bid Assessment
  • Opportunity Prioritization
  • Commercial Risk Review
  • Stakeholder Analysis
  • Competitive Positioning
  • Resource Allocation Strategy

Disciplined opportunity selection improves both win rates and profitability.

Common Commercial Challenges

Across the EPC sector, we frequently observe organizations facing challenges such as:

  • Limited visibility into upcoming projects
  • Reactive rather than proactive business development
  • Difficulty accessing project decision-makers
  • Weak relationships with project owners and consultants
  • Inconsistent bid qualification processes
  • Fragmented supplier and OEM networks
  • Dependence on a small number of clients
  • Limited international technology partnerships
  • Difficulty expanding into new industrial sectors or regions

These issues often constrain growth despite strong engineering capabilities.
